ABX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review
6 of the 6,864 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Abacus Global Management (ABX)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$2.71M — up 69% from $1.6M a quarter earlier.
Fund positioning in ABX was balanced in Q4 2023: 2 funds opened new positions, 2 closed out, 2 added to existing stakes and 0 trimmed.
The largest buyer was AE Wealth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$205K. The largest seller was Barclays, exiting entirely with an estimated $47.3K sold.
